Focal Sib Evo Review – Home Theater

The Focal Sib Evo 5.1.2 Home Cinema System is intended to replicate the real theatre experience at home. It has a 5.1.2 system with Dolby Atmos installed. In order to create the illusion of 3D sound, the front loudspeakers are built to project sounds vertically upward. The Dolby Atmos technology is made feasible by two loudspeakers, three satellite speakers, one subwoofer, and one extra speaker driver on top of the box. The system is perfect for rooms up to 540 square feet in size.

The 5.1.2-channel configuration is designed to produce high-quality immersive audio in a single easy-to-install kit. With the Focal Sib Evo Dolby Atmos 5.1.2 Home Cinema system, you can enhance the sound in your home theatre without having to deal with the difficulties that come with installing cables into your ceiling. This is made possible by the front left and right speakers’ top firing design. You may upgrade to Dolby Atmos if your receiver supports the format by connecting two wires to the front speakers.

Design


Design

The Focal Sib Evo 5.1.2 surround sound system is reasonably priced, yet the speakers and subwoofer are of high quality. With curved cabinets, mesh grilles, and an appealing gloss black finish, the design is both contemporary and lifestyle-friendly.

The Dolby Atmos speakers are somewhat bigger and have an indentation on the top that houses the upward-firing driver. There are four tiny holes in the back for the speaker wire, and both speakers rest on sturdy rubber supports that may be tilted properly.

The three Satellite speakers each feature two holes in the back for the speaker cord, and their stands may be positioned vertically or horizontally (you can rotate the Focal badge as well, which is a nice touch). There are also two brackets provided for wall mounting the surround speakers.

Sound Quality

Sound Quality

The Focal Sib Evo 5.1.2 has a dynamic front soundstage with accurate and precise delivery from the left and right speakers, as well as clear and focused conversation from the center. The matching tweeters and woofers ensure great tonal balance, creating a fantastic sense of coherence. The surrounds fit in with the rest of the system, while the subwoofer provides a strong bass foundation for the other speakers.

When it comes to Dolby Atmos and DTS:X soundtracks, the upward-firing drivers excel at producing the required overhead effects, resulting in an exciting and immersive auditory experience in which audio objects are directed smoothly about the room, gliding flawlessly from speaker to speaker. The effects of the greatest object-based audio soundtracks are frequently spectacular, and Despite its small size, the sub has a lot of low-end oomph.

Conclusion

The Sib Evo Dolby Atmos from Focal offers good performance for the money. With the exception of a few minor flaws, such the tricky spring-loaded wire connections, these speakers are stylish, well-designed, and well constructed. They perform admirably with both music and movies. We was far less thrilled, though, with Dolby Atmos’ ability to fulfil its promise without requiring the purchase of ceiling-mounted speakers.

The home theater’s acoustics may be to blame for this; perhaps the ceiling is simply too high for up-firing speakers to work properly. After all, a few months ago, We had a comparable experience with Creative’s new Sonic Carrier soundbar. Give the Focal Sib Evo a try if you want the Dolby Atmos experience without drilling holes in your ceiling, you have a powerful A/V receiver, and it matches your budget; it could be perfect for your home theatre. Just make sure the vendor from whom you’re purchasing it accepts returns in the event that it doesn’t.
